## Test plan: Keyturner rotation utility (on-call notes)

Scope: verify Keyturner rotates secrets in the Vantrel vault without dropping live sessions. Steps: run rotation in dry-run mode, confirm diff output lists exactly the expiring set, then execute against staging. Check that dependent services pick up new values within 60s; anything slower pages. Rollback: `keyturner revert --last`. Staging API calls during verification must authenticate using the bearer token below.

session JWT of yawep-yawep = eyJhbGciOiJIUzI1NiIsInR5cCI6IkpXVCJ9.eyJzdWIiOiI3pWF3_In0.aXYsHiog

Subject: SQL linting heads-up

Hey — since you're reviewing from the security side: all SQL files in the Moorhen repo now go through sqlfence pre-commit. It flags string concatenation, missing parameter binding, and grants wider than read. Overrides need a reviewer sign-off. The full rule list and exemption process are documented here.

wiki page, bagaf-fawip: https://harbor.tolvaqsys.local/pages/repo/pages/secrets/eac969ffc71f356b

## Ownership

Welcome aboard! This repo holds Keyturner, our internal secrets-rotation utility. It rotates service credentials on a schedule and nags you in chat when something fails, so please don't mute it. If you're changing rotation logic, run the dry-run suite first — a botched rotation once locked out half the staging cluster and nobody enjoyed that week. Questions about design decisions go in the team channel. For anything else, the current maintainer and final word on merges is listed below.

account owner for fajep-yagef: Kasix Eliiel